| Origin | By resolution 4 C/Res. 29.1, adopted at its 4th session en 1949, the General Conference established the Headquarters Committee.
The Headquarters Committee is governed by Rules 39, 39bis and 40 of the Rules of Procedure of the General Conference, amended by 31 C/Res. 65 adopted by the General Conference at its 31st session in 2001. | ||||||||||||
| Functions | To advise the Director-General on all questions relating to the Organization’s Headquarters submitted by the Director-General or by a member of the Committee, and to provide the Director-General with advice, suggestions, guidance and recommendations in this connection.

| Composition | The Committee consists of 24 Member States elected for four years, half of whom are replaced at each session.
At its 32nd session, the General Conference elected the following Member States to be members of the Committee: Colombia, Congo, Democratic People's Republic of Korea*, Dominican Republic*, Finland*, France, Iraq*, Japan*, Kenya, Madagascar, Malawi*, Mauritania*, Mauritius*, Monaco*, Oman, Panama, Philippines, Romania, Rwanda*, Sri Lanka*, Thailand, Turkey*, Ukraine, Uruguay. The term of office of the Member States indicated by an asterisk expires at the end of the 33rd session of the General Conference. The term of office of the other members will expire at the 34th session. | ||||||||||||

| Meetings foreseen during the biennium | The Committee meets whenever necessary to treat questions relating to Headquarters submitted by the Director-General or by one of the members of the Committee. | ||||||||||||
